Get your team together and dive into the synth-filled, big-hair brilliance of the 1980s with this 50-question group trivia session. It’s ideal for online or in-person game nights on Zoom, Microsoft Teams, Google Meet, YouTube Live, Twitch, or any streaming setup. For a smooth flow, split the quiz into five 10-question rounds or themed blocks (music, film & TV, pop culture, events, and wildcards), give teams 15–30 seconds per question, and add a mid-quiz leaderboard reveal to keep the energy high. Encourage fun team names, quick debates, and light banter—this is built for friendly competition, not solo play. Optional: add brief audio or visual hints where appropriate (if you have the rights) and finish with a sudden-death tiebreaker for a dramatic finale.
